Senior R&D Engineer CFD & Optimization (Remote)

Diabatix is seeking a motivated and technically strong R&D Engineer to join their development team. The role involves researching, developing, and implementing advanced CFD- and optimization-based methods that power Diabatix’s generative design technology.

ConsultingInformation TechnologySoftware

Responsibilities

Develop, implement, and validate advanced CFD-based methods for thermal analysis and design optimization
Contribute to the development of adjoint-based optimization and gradient-driven design workflows
Work with and extend CFD solvers, preferably OpenFOAM, including model development, solver customization, and performance improvements
Design and implement optimization algorithms for geometry and system-level design problems
Collaborate with application and product teams to translate industrial requirements into R&D priorities and technical solutions
Evaluate, prototype, and integrate AI/ML techniques where relevant, particularly for geometry handling, surrogate modeling, or physics-aware acceleration
Ensure robustness, accuracy, and scalability of algorithms for real-world industrial use cases
Participate in code reviews, testing, documentation, and knowledge sharing within the R&D team
Stay up to date with academic and industrial developments in CFD, optimization, and simulation-driven design

Qualification

Computational fluid dynamics (CFD)Numerical optimization methodsOpenFOAMC++ programmingAI/ML applied to physicsAnalytical skillsProblem-solving mindsetCommunication skills

Required

Master's degree or PhD in Engineering, Applied Mathematics, Computer Science, or a related technical field
Strong background in computational fluid dynamics (CFD) and thermal engineering
Experience with numerical optimization methods; adjoint methods are a strong plus
Hands-on experience with OpenFOAM development and C++ programming is highly desirable
Solid understanding of numerical methods, discretization techniques, and solver architectures
Ability to work independently on complex technical problems in a fast-paced R&D environment
Strong analytical skills and a structured, problem-solving mindset
Good communication skills and ability to collaborate across disciplines

Preferred

Experience or interest in AI/ML applied to physics-based problems (e.g. surrogate models, physics-informed ML, geometry representations) is a bonus
